Understanding the Fundamentals: Essential Skills for IT Audit Controls

To excel in IT audit controls, individuals need to possess a combination of technical, business, and analytical skills. Some of the essential skills that an Undergraduate Certificate in Information Technology Audit Controls can help you develop include proficiency in programming languages, data analysis, and risk assessment. You will also learn about IT governance frameworks, such as COBIT and ITIL, and how to apply them in real-world scenarios. Furthermore, you will gain a deep understanding of regulatory requirements, including HIPAA, PCI-DSS, and SOX, and how to ensure compliance. By acquiring these skills, you will be well-equipped to identify and mitigate potential risks, ensuring the integrity and security of IT systems.

Best Practices for IT Audit Controls: A Practical Approach

To ensure the effectiveness of IT audit controls, it is crucial to follow best practices that have been proven to work in real-world scenarios. One of the key best practices is to adopt a risk-based approach to auditing, which involves identifying and prioritizing potential risks and developing targeted audit plans to address them. Another best practice is to leverage technology, such as audit software and data analytics tools, to streamline the audit process and improve efficiency. Additionally, it is essential to maintain effective communication with stakeholders, including management, IT staff, and external auditors, to ensure that everyone is aware of their roles and responsibilities. By following these best practices, you can ensure that your IT audit controls are effective, efficient, and aligned with organizational objectives.

Career Opportunities in IT Audit Controls: A World of Possibilities

An Undergraduate Certificate in Information Technology Audit Controls can open up a world of career opportunities in a variety of industries, including finance, healthcare, government, and technology. Some of the potential career paths include IT auditor, risk manager, compliance officer, and information security specialist. With the increasing demand for skilled professionals in this field, you can expect competitive salaries and excellent job prospects.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, employment of information security analysts, including IT auditors, is projected to grow 31% from 2020 to 2030, much faster than the average for all occupations. Staying Ahead of the Curve: Continuous Learning and Professional Development

The field of IT audit controls is constantly evolving, with new technologies, regulations, and threats emerging all the time. To stay ahead of the curve, it is essential to commit to continuous learning and professional development. This can involve pursuing advanced certifications, such as the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A) or Certified Information Security Manager (CISM), attending industry conferences and workshops, and participating in online forums and communities. By staying up-to-date with the latest developments and best practices, you can ensure that your skills and knowledge remain relevant and in demand, and that you are well-positioned to advance in your career.
